A Hierarchical Regionalization-Based Load Shedding Plan to Recover Frequency and Voltage in Microgrid
Abstract
In microgrids, where the holistically centralized techniques do not meet the speed requirement, regionalization can be a viable solution to improve and speed up protection and control applications. This paper presents a fast regionalized approach to mitigate the microgrid voltage and frequency deviations simultaneously.
